Post by Gerda on Sept 4, 2007 19:59:53 GMT
To get the most out of the speedies, they are played in concentration mode to get tripple the bonus. Best is to play them fresh after being bumped up to the maximum bonus of 10.000 points. That is pretty easy if one has version 1.2, but almost impossible with version 1.3
For reaching the creators list you need to create loads of very popular layouts. The list is based on how many times the layouts of a player are played all together.

Post by Gerda on Sept 6, 2007 20:30:02 GMT
You intentionally lose one or more games to increase the points. That is right. As I said before, it is almost impossible to bump with version 1.3. You have to stay in the game for 30 seconds without finishing it before it is an attempt. That you have to do ten times.
Getting 10 seconds penalty for a hint and 60 seconds for shuffle occurs after 30 seconds in version 1.3. With version 1.2 you get that rightaway and you have to stay in a game only for 5 seconds to make it a lost attempt.
The first ten times a game is played it remains 2500 bonus points. If you play a game attempted less than 10 times, in concentration mode you end up with 2500 bonus points. Speedies become interested, being attempted 10 times with zero success. At that point it is worth 10.000 points. That high bonus lowers rapidly of course. Speedies are too easy to stay that high.
